PREP BASEBALL ‘95: PREVIEW : Sea View League

Share

Coaches: Joe Koh, Corona del Mar; Tom McCaffrey, El Toro; Bob Flint, Irvine; Kirk Bates, Newport Harbor; Tip Lefebvre, Santa Margarita; Sam Favata, Woodbridge.

Facts and Figures: Santa Margarita returns all nine starters and is the favorite to win the league. The Eagles are deep in experience--15 seniors and six juniors make up their 21-man roster. . . . Newport Harbor returns eight starters, including Joe Urban, who tied for second in the county in home runs (seven) last season. . . . Corona del Mar is expected to be a factor in the race. . . . Woodbridge should combine good pitching with average hitting. . . . Irvine returns six starters, but even Flint admits, “We have too many unknowns to be overly optimistic.” . . . El Toro’s pitching staff returns a combined five victories from last season.

Highlights: Tustin, now in the Golden West League, won the league title by five games. Saddleback (also now in the Golden West) and Irvine were part of a five-way tie for second and went to the Division III playoffs. Saddleback and Tustin were eliminated in the second round; Irvine lost in the wild-card game. . . . Saddleback pitcher Tony Zuniga was voted player of the year.
